I posted a problem yesterday and received an email from Mozilla Support asking me for information. I have NO IDEA how to find my original support problem to add comments - PLEASE let me know HOW to answer the Mozilla Support email (other than this way). Here is what I got in the email:

"I can replicate the issue in 105.0.3 and see that it works in Chrome. see screenshot What version of macOS? What version of Firefox are you running?"

My answers are: macOS Monterey 12.6 (put on a few days ago - upgrade from Big Sur) 105.0.3 (64 bit) - which is marked "Up to date"

So, I have the latest operating system for my MacBook AIr and the latest Firefox Browser and the display issue still exists.

You can hover your logged-in name that is shown in the top right corner of a SUMO page and click "My Questions".
